‘Mall house,’ wild ‘spaceport’ or something else? Check out this Illinois home for sale
Some houses with a spectacularly large interior could be considered a dream come true for folks hunting around the real estate market for extra space.
But is there such a thing as “too much” space?
A dramatically vast estate for sale in St. Charles, Illinois, for $2.99 million puts that question to test.
The six-bedroom, 10-bathroom residence — a whopping 13,805 square feet — is referred to as a “paradise” in its listing on Zillow.com.
It also comes with a great many amenities, including:
High ceilings
Chef’s kitchen
Garden atrium
Theater
Indoor pool
In-law living area
Gym with locker room
Outdoor pool with waterfall
Tennis courts
Gazebo
The outside is pretty spectacular, too, with “vast gardens and foliage developed by Japanese landscape artist Hoichi Kuisu.”
